How much did houses on Charlton Street, RM20 Grays sell for?

The most recent registered sale is 35 Charlton Street, sold for £350,000 in June 2025. 5 registered sales on Charlton Street since January 2024, dominated by terraced houses (80% of activity). Average sale price £268,500. That's 9% below the RM20 area average of £295,108.

What Charlton Street is like

Charlton Street is almost entirely terraced. That accounts for 4 of the 5 recorded sales (80%).

Tenure is mixed: 80% freehold, 20% leasehold.

Sold prices have ranged from £175,000 to £350,000, with a median of £265,000.
